Subject: On-call basics for the Inkrun pipeline

Welcome to the rotation. Inkrun renders all markdown for Fablewood docs. Most pages fail at the sanitizer stage — check the dead-letter queue first, requeue if the payload parses locally. Never restart the render fleet during business hours without pinging the lead. Escalate anything involving template injection immediately. The full runbook, including paging rules and queue commands, is here.

wiki page, tahaf-tajog: https://jira.ordindyn.corp/pipeline

The Pointsgrove loyalty-points ledger is append-only; releases never mutate historical entries. As release manager, you gate every deploy on a successful ledger checksum run against the internal Tallyhouse service. Checksums run automatically in CI but must be re-verified manually before production cutover. Rollbacks re-point the reader, never the writer. Access to Tallyhouse staging requires the shared release credential, stored in the deploy vault and mirrored here for convenience. The current staging key follows.

service key, fawip-bajef: kto11_Qt5wZK9vdNC

// REINDEX_BATCH_CAP limits docs per shard pass in the Tallowfield
// nightly search reindex. Raising it starves the ingest queue;
// lowering it overruns the maintenance window. 5000 is the tested
// sweet spot. Change only with a soak run. Verified against the
// build noted below.

session token of bawif-hahog = htk6_ac5981

## Ownership

SproutCycle, our plant-watering scheduler, is maintained by the Greenhouse Automation pod at Fernwell Labs. If watering jobs stall or the moisture sensors stop reporting, check the scheduler queue before escalating. Configuration changes require pod sign-off. For anything urgent during an incident, page the service owner directly. The current owner is listed below.

named custodian: Belius Casath Ulaix Sorius